#b3c665 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b3c665 is composed of 70.2% red, 77.6% green and 39.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 9.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 49% yellow and 22.4% black. It has a hue angle of 71.8 degrees, a saturation of 46% and a lightness of 58.6%. #b3c665 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ffca with #678d00. Closest websafe color is: #cccc66.

● #b3c665 color description : Slightly desaturated yellow.
#b3c665 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b3c665 has RGB values of R:179, G:198, B:101 and CMYK values of C:0.1, M:0, Y:0.49,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 11781733.

Shades and Tints of #b3c665
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030301 is the darkest color, while #fafbf4 is the lightest one.
